First the facts.
Euro engine has 263hp and 251 torque, is 2.0 litre engine and has a 7,500 rpm redline.
USDM has 300hp and 300 torque, is 2.5 litre engine and has a 7,000 rpm redline.
Now from what i understand the 6 speed gearbox in our car is the same gearbox in the much different Euro STI. I mean it has the same gear ratios and everything. So am i wrong in thinking that this gearbox is a mismatch? We should have our own gearbox with ratios for our engine in order to maximize our engine's abilities... right?
